Bill Pizzimenti is an experienced manufacturing engineering professional with over 35 years of expertise in assembly system development, automation, and new vehicle launches. Bill has a strong background in building high-performing teams and optimizing processes to improve timing, cost efficiency, and product quality. His career is marked by significant accomplishments in indirect purchasing, delivering substantial cost savings, developing sourcing strategies, and negotiating with suppliers. Bill is highly skilled in collaborating with global teams to drive operational excellence and continuous improvement across various industries.
Currently serving as a Senior Account Manager for Welding Systems at Fori Automation, Bill is responsible for maintaining relationships with Tier I customers, leading cross-functional teams, and managing commercial negotiations for welding automation projects. Previously, Bill held key roles at Stellantis, including Indirect Senior Buyer for Body-in-White tooling, robotics, and automation, where he managed multi-million-dollar purchases and achieved significant savings of $30M–$90M annually. As a Proposal Manager and Launch Execution Manager at Stellantis, Bill played a crucial role in developing assembly solutions, managing large-scale projects, and successfully launching numerous new vehicle programs.
Bill’s career has also included positions in operations process improvement and process engineering, where he optimized manufacturing processes and contributed to the launch of several vehicle programs on time and within budget. Throughout his career, he has demonstrated a commitment to continuous improvement, cost optimization, and effective supplier relationship management. With a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ering from Lawrence Technological University, Bill combines technical expertise with a deep understanding of manufacturing processes and project management.
